Simplicity Yeoman 648 Garden Tractor

The Simplicity Yeoman 648 is a garden tractor produced in the early 1970s. Designed for residential lawn care and light property maintenance, this compact machine represents the standard utility equipment manufactured by Simplicity during that era.

Engine and Powertrain

The tractor is powered by a Briggs & Stratton 190707 gasoline engine. This single-cylinder, air-cooled unit features a vertical shaft configuration with a displacement of 318 cc (19.44 ci) and produces a gross power output of 8 hp (6.0 kW). The engine is equipped with a 12-volt electric starting system.

Transmission and Mechanicals

Power is delivered to the wheels through a belt-driven gear transmission, providing three forward gears and one reverse gear. The tractor features a two-wheel drive system and manual steering. It is configured with an independent mid-mounted Power Take-Off (PTO) operated by a manual clutch, allowing for the attachment of various implements, including a 32-inch mower deck.

Dimensions and Chassis

The Yeoman 648 is built on an open operator station chassis with a wheelbase of 36.5 inches (92 cm). The unit has an overall length of 53.5 inches (135 cm) and a width of 30 inches (76 cm). Weighing approximately 288 lbs (130 kg), it is equipped with lawn and turf tires sized 4.10/3.50x6 at the front and 16-7.50x8 at the rear.

Dimension and Tires Information of Simplicity, Yeoman 648

Rear tread21.5 inches [54 cm]
Wheelbase36.5 inches [92 cm]
Height (hood)28.5 inches [72 cm]
Height (steering wheel)33 inches [83 cm]
Length53.5 inches [135 cm]
Weight288 lbs [130 kg]
Width30 inches [76 cm]
Lawn/turf front4.10/3.50x6
Lawn/turf rear16-7.50x8

Engine Specifications of Simplicity, Yeoman 648

  • Briggs & Stratton 190707
  • Air-cooled vertical-shaft
  • Gasoline
  • 1-cylinder
Power (gross)8 hp [6.0 kW]
Displacement318 cc [19.44 ci]
StarterElectric
Bore/Stroke3.00x2.75 inches [76 x 70 mm]
Starter volts12

Transmission Information of Simplicity, Yeoman 648

Transmission variants 1

TypeBelt-driven gear
Gears3 forward and 1 reverse
